    split theme

    Multiple distinct (and usually opposite) themes being represented at the same time, with a split between them as a way to represent contrast.

    The simplest way to do this is to have two opposite themes on each side with a clean split in the middle (see split screen).

    Examples:

    • Two different characters being portrayed as one (post #1318355)
    • While a character is in the middle of a henshin transformation (post #1841349)
    • Revealing the "true nature" of a character (post #6870337)
    • Comparing how a character looked when they were younger to when they're older
